|
@@ -27,8 +27,8 @@
|
|
|
<el-form-item
|
|
|
label="高危条件"
|
|
|
label-width="110px"
|
|
|
- prop="planName"
|
|
|
- v-if="operationForm.opgrade === 2"
|
|
|
+ prop="opgrade"
|
|
|
+ v-if="operationForm.opgrade == 2"
|
|
|
>
|
|
|
<span
|
|
|
style="paddingLeft: 12px; color: #606266"
|
|
@@ -46,7 +46,7 @@ export default {
|
|
|
data() {
|
|
|
let checkFrequency = (rule, value, callback) => {
|
|
|
let opgrade = this.$refs.opgrade.value;
|
|
|
- if (opgrade === '') {
|
|
|
+ if (opgrade === '' || opgrade === null) {
|
|
|
callback('请选择手术级别');
|
|
|
} else {
|
|
|
callback();
|
|
@@ -66,7 +66,8 @@ export default {
|
|
|
trigger: ['blur', 'change']
|
|
|
}
|
|
|
]
|
|
|
- }
|
|
|
+ },
|
|
|
+
|
|
|
};
|
|
|
},
|
|
|
computed: {},
|
|
@@ -76,6 +77,7 @@ export default {
|
|
|
mounted() {},
|
|
|
methods: {
|
|
|
_initData() {
|
|
|
+ console.log(this.data);
|
|
|
this.operationForm.opgrade = this.data.opgrade;
|
|
|
this.operationForm.highriskcond = this.data.highriskcond;
|
|
|
},
|